I ordered a pitman arm for my power steering box on the 67 dart.
Box came out of a 69 dart.

The arm i have is way off. The hole is too big and the joint is in the opposite direction. I believe this arm comes from a 73+ dart.

What part number am i actually looking for?
I measured the inner part of the splines. (not accurately) and i got 1.01 inches. Would i be using moog part number 7074?
 
theres also a possibility that its from a 67...the earlyer 67 68 had a flipped over setup mid 68 is when it seems to have changed.....try ordering one for a 70..more than a few times ive gotten the wrong pitman and idler cause of the switchovers

or atleast thats what my memory is telling me...i know there was a minor change that made everything different on the 67 compared to a 69
 
The part you got is for a '73-up, when they went to the larger splines. I'm thinking the K7074 is the beast you want, as it's listed '67-'72 A-body power. The '67 used the oddball one-year-only idler arm, but the pitman is shown as being the same as '68-up.
